Odisha’s Swastik Samal hits double century in Vijay Hazare Trophy match

Odisha batsman Swastik Samal played a brilliant innings of 212 runs off 169 balls against Saurashtra in the Vijay Hazare Trophy. He achieved this feat in Alur. With this double century, Samal became the first batsman from Odisha to achieve this milestone in the history of List A cricket. This is also the fifth-highest score in the history of the Vijay Hazare Trophy, surpassing the 203 runs scored by Yashasvi Jaiswal while playing for Mumbai in 2019. Thanks to Samal's excellent innings, Odisha scored 345 runs for 6 wickets in 50 overs against Saurashtra.


Undrafted in the IPL Auction

Swastik Samal, along with his teammate Rajesh Mohanty, was included in the IPL 2026 auction, but he was not bought by any team. The 25-year-old Samal opened the innings for Odisha and gave his team a good start. However, after the dismissals of Om, Sandeep Patnaik, and Govind Poddar, Odisha was in trouble, losing three wickets for 59 runs in 11.5 overs.


Rescued the innings with Biplab Samantray

Samal then had to rebuild the innings with captain Biplab Samantray. This meant he had to bat till the end. In this partnership, both batsmen added 261 runs off 211 balls, with Samantray completing his century and Samal contributing 156 runs to the partnership. Samal was dismissed on the fourth ball of the last over, but by then he had guided his team to a massive score. Samal's innings included 21 fours and 8 sixes. This was his 14th List A match for Odisha, and he became the 14th Indian player to score a double century in List A cricket.


Vijay Hazare Records

In terms of the highest scores in the Vijay Hazare Trophy, N Jagadeesan tops the list with 277 (141 balls), a score he achieved against Arunachal Pradesh on November 21, 2022. This is followed by Prithvi Shaw's 227 (152 balls), scored against Puducherry on February 25, 2021. Ruturaj Gaikwad scored 220 (159 balls) against Uttar Pradesh on November 28, 2022. Sanju Samson scored 212 (129 balls) against Goa on October 12, 2019. Now, Swastik Samal joins this list with his score of 212 (169 balls) against Saurashtra on December 24, 2025.
